WebThe robot can weld real-world parts with variation. Your quality goes up and your teaching time goes down. Adaptive !ll senses the edges of the weld joint as the robot weaves back and forth. The robot then adjusts the amplitude of the weave points based on the arc sensing at the weaving edges. The robot will adjust
